The Impact Of Wood Acoustic Panels On Room Sound Quality

In the realm of room acoustics, it’s often the subtle elements that make a profound difference. Among the most effective of these is the use of wood acoustic panels, which can transform the aural landscape of any given space.

The challenge of noise pollution

Often underappreciated, sound quality is a critical aspect of the overall experience within a room, whether it’s a home theater, office space, or a professional recording studio. Poor acoustics can lead to noise pollution, a phenomenon that can decrease productivity and enjoyment.

The role of wood panels

The issue arises from sound waves bouncing off the walls, floors, and ceilings, causing echoes, reverb, and a muddling of sounds that can lead to a poor listening experience. To mitigate these effects, one of the most effective solutions is the installation of wood acoustic panels.

Design and versatility of wood panels

Wood panels provide both aesthetic appeal and practical acoustic improvements. Made from perforated or grooved timber, these panels work by breaking up sound reflections, thus controlling reverberation and enhancing sound clarity. They can also absorb certain frequencies while reflecting others, allowing for the fine-tuning of a room’s acoustical character.

Alternatives to wood panels

However, wood panels are not the only solution available for acoustic enhancements. Depending on the specific needs and constraints of a given room, other options might be more appropriate.

Foam panels and bass traps

For instance, foam acoustic panels are lightweight and relatively easy to install, offering effective absorption of mid to high frequency sounds. However, they may not offer the same depth of sound improvement or visual appeal as wood panels. Bass traps, typically placed in corners where low-frequency sound tends to accumulate, are another excellent choice for improving room acoustics.

The role of diffusers

Diffusers are yet another effective tool for improving room acoustics. They scatter sound waves in different directions rather than absorbing them, helping to create a balanced sound environment.

Combining acoustic treatments

In some cases, the best solution might involve a combination of these treatments. For example, one might combine wood panels with foam panels, bass traps, and diffusers to create a balanced sound environment that caters to a wide range of frequencies.

In conclusion, optimizing the acoustics of a room can significantly improve the sound experience within it. Among the many solutions available, wood acoustic panels stand out for their effectiveness and their aesthetic appeal. But ultimately, the best results often come from a well-thought-out mix of different treatments, tailored to the specific needs of the room and those using it.
